The industrial activity in Querétaro recorded a positive but moderate behavior during October 2025, according to the Monthly Indicator of Industrial Activity by Federal Entity of the INEGI. The data reflect a monthly increase of 0.3 percent and an annual growth of 3.6 percent, which confirms a stable performance in the national industrial context. With increases of 36.6%, 11.6% and 10.2%, Oaxaca, Colima and Nayarit, respectively, were the federative entities that recorded the greatest growth in their industrial activity, at a monthly rate, during October 2025, according to the results of the National Institute of Statistics and Geography (Inegi).
